I'm a complete newbie to this game so need lots of advice!!!

I have recently bought my 1st dslr a mint nikon D200, i then bought a 2nd hand but almost new 18-55vr lens, i already posted a few questions on here and felt i got a few raised eyebrows when getting this lens as i initially was looking for a 18-70 lens.

After using this lens verses an older lens i borrowed of a mate i feel the older lens was a lot sharper, being new to this i'm not sure if it is just my opinion or if i was trying a lot harder with it being my 1st time out.

So the question is should i stick with this lens or buy the 18-70 lens which i can currently get for approx £165 from Clifton Cameras or try to get the Tamron 18-55 2.8 lens which look to be selling for around the £175 mark on ebay, if i went for a new lens i would sell my current lens to offset some of the cost.

Not sure if i'm talking crackers or not!!, any help/recommendations will be most welcome.

No, your impressions are correct. I tried my 18-70 DX lens on a D60 against a friend's 18-55 VR on his D60 and my combo was much sharper, particularly out towards 50mm.

Its not that the 18-55 VR is bad, its just that the 18-70 DX is excellent.
 
If you after one of the 18-70 you should give London Camera exchange a call on the strand, I think you will get it cheaper than that as they have some second hand ones in stock I think.
